Keto Friendly Sauteed Spinach
Description
A quick, easy, tasty side dish that would compliment any meal. Try it on pizza!
Ingredients
- Fresh baby spinach
- 1–2 tablespoons Olive oil
- 1 yellow bell pepper, chopped
- 1 shallot, finely chopped
- 1 garlic clove, minced
- 2–3 tablespoons bacon pieces
- sea salt & black pepper to taste
Instructions
- Heat olive oil over medium-high heat.
- Add everything except the spinach and saute until slightly softened and aromatic.
- Add spinach and saute, stirring frequently, until wilted or cook until desired consistency.
